Market Overview:
The global silane gas market is expected to grow at a CAGR of 5.5% during the forecast period from 2018 to 2030. The growth in the market can be attributed to the increasing demand for semiconductors and displays across the globe. Silane gas is used as a precursor in semiconductor manufacturing and display fabrication processes, which is driving its demand globally. Additionally, rising investments in photovoltaic (PV) installations are also contributing to the growth of the global silane gas market.
